Q: Is 39,846 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 39,846 is a composite number.

Why is 39,846 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 39,846 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 29 58 87 174 229 458 687 1,374 6,641 13,282 19,923 and 39,846, with no remainder.

Since 39,846 cannot be divided by just 1 and 39,846, it is a composite number.
